Finance at University of Central Florida

If you are interested in studying Finance, take a look at what University of Central Florida. Get started with the following essential facts.

University of Central Florida sits in Orlando, FL.

For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, 379 finance degrees were awarded at University of Central Florida.

Online Class Availability at University of Central Florida

Many students take online classes at University of Central Florida. Among 69,713 students, 12,508 (18%) studied exclusively online and 31,060 (45%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Take a look at the student demographics for Finance graduates at University of Central Florida, broken down by degree level.

Program-wide, Finance graduates at University of Central Florida are 25% women (95) and 75% men (284).

Finance Bachelor’s Program at University of Central Florida

Among the 379 bachelor’s finance graduates at University of Central Florida, 25% were women (95) and 75% were men (284).

University of Central Florida gender breakdown of Finance Bachelor's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Finance bachelor’s degree recipients at University of Central Florida.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 172
Hispanic / Latino 109
Black / African American 24
Asian 40
Native Hawaiian / Pacific Islander 1
Two or More Races 16
International (Nonresident) 17
Racial-ethnic diversity of Finance majors at University of Central Florida

Minority students account for 50% of Finance bachelor’s degree recipients at University of Central Florida, above the national average of 29%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
